Keeping Your Waste Containers Clean and Sanitary
Prevent unpleasant odors and potential hygiene hazards by regularly cleaning your waste containers. Begin by emptying the trash regularly. Rinse the container with hot water and laundry soap, paying special attention to any residue. Allow the container to air dry completely before placing a fresh trash bag inside. For stubborn stains, you can use a baking soda solution.
It's important to choose the right type of garbage bags for your container size and amount of waste generated. Overfilling your containers can lead to spills. Regularly inspect your containers for any damage and repair or replace them as needed.

Optimizing Your Waste Management with Smart Bins
In today's sustainable world, optimized waste management is essential. Smart bins are revolutionizing the way we dispose of our waste, offering a selection of advantages that enhance to a cleaner future. These innovative bins are laden with technology that track fill levels, optimize collection schedules, and even detect different types of waste, enabling more precise sorting.
- Moreover, smart bins can minimize overflowing bins, eliminating unpleasant odors and potential health hazards.
- Via implementing smart bin systems, municipalities can improve waste collection routes, decreasing fuel consumption and emissions.
- Consequently, smart bins contribute to a more sustainable approach to waste management, advantageing both the nature and citizens.
